Zobrazeno 1 - 3
of 3
pro vyhledávání: '"Paley Li"'
Publikováno v:
OOPSLA Companion
Cloning is an essential feature in many object-oriented programs. Unfortunately, existing techniques generally copy too little or too much. We present an object cloning technique that uses the object structure enforced by ownership types to produce t
Publikováno v:
OOPSLA
The Java language lacks the important notions of ownership (an object owns its representation to prevent unwanted aliasing) and immutability (the division into mutable, immutable, and readonly data and references). Programmers are prone to design err
Publikováno v:
International Workshop on Aliasing, Confinement and Ownership in Object-Oriented Programming.
Ownership systems express hierarchical data structures well but can have difficulty expressing relationships between peers. Relationships systems, on the other hand, do not address ownership issues. This paper considers the recent work on relationshi